Job Summary:
We are a leading plastic manufacturing company operating under Export Processing Enterprise (EPE) regulations, supplying both domestic and international markets. To support our continued growth and commitment to operational excellence, we are seeking a highly organized and detail-oriented Assistant Supply Chain Manager.
This role is responsible for supporting the Supply Chain Manager in overseeing the coordination, reporting, and operational follow-up across the Planning, Logistics, and Warehouse functions. While the direct operational ownership lies with the respective Officers, the Assistant Supply Chain Manager ensures that activities are aligned, issues are escalated timely, and data is properly consolidated for management decision-making.
Candidates must have hands-on experience in supply chain activities within an EPE factory environment, a strong understanding of compliance requirements, and excellent coordination and reporting skills.
Key Responsibilities:
1) Planning Support
- Assist the Planning team in consolidating production schedules, raw material requirements, and order fulfillment status.
- Track daily, weekly, and monthly production performance against the approved plan; identify and escalate deviations.
- Support the preparation of Material Requirement Planning (MRP) reports based on customer orders, forecasts, and material inventory.
- Follow up with the Production, Sales, Procurement, and Warehouse teams to ensure material availability for planned production.
- Coordinate plan adjustments in case of raw material delays, machine breakdowns, or urgent customer orders.
- Assist in production planning reporting, including Plan vs. Actual, production capacity utilization, and production backlog analysis.
2) Logistics Support
- Work closely with the Logistics team to monitor inbound material arrivals, outbound finished goods shipments, and delivery timelines.
- Support in preparing logistics documentation such as commercial invoices, packing lists, shipping instructions, and certificates of origin.
- Track and report on logistics performance indicators: On-Time Delivery (OTD), lead times, freight costs, and shipment damages.
- Follow up with freight forwarders, customs brokers, and internal teams to ensure smooth import-export operations.
- Assist in customs clearance coordination to ensure full compliance with EPE regulations.
- Support cost control initiatives by tracking logistics expenses and proposing improvement actions.
3) Warehouse Coordination Support
- Support the Warehouse team in tracking inventory movements for raw materials, WIP, and finished goods.
- Assist in reconciling stock data between ERP systems and physical stock reports.
- Coordinate and follow up on monthly cycle counts, annual stock takes, and inventory audits.
- Monitor warehouse KPIs including inventory accuracy, warehouse utilization rates, inbound and outbound productivity.
- Support initiatives for warehouse layout optimization, FIFO practices, and safety compliance.
- Ensure warehouse operations comply with EPE-specific customs requirements, including proper material segregation and traceability.

6) EPE Compliance Support
- Support the Import-Export and Warehouse teams in maintaining full compliance with customs regulations applicable to EPE factories.
- Assist in preparing customs reconciliation reports, liquidation reports, and documentation for customs audits and inspections.
- Monitor and update records required by customs, such as raw material balances, finished goods balances, and production scrap reporting.
- Ensure that inventory movements are recorded in accordance with customs and EPE guidelines to prevent penalties or operational disruptions.
